- What is Yum! Brands's company sales — revenue?
- Yum! Brands (YUM) reported company sales — revenue of $785M in Q1 2026.
- How has Yum! Brands's company sales — revenue changed year-over-year?
- Yum! Brands's company sales — revenue increased by 29.3% year-over-year, from $607M to $785M.
- What is the long-term trend for Yum! Brands's company sales — revenue?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Yum! Brands's company sales — revenue has grown at a 8.7%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$2.11B to $2.94B.
- What does company sales — revenue mean?
- This metric represents the total revenue generated from restaurant units directly owned and operated by the company, rather than those operated by franchisees. It reflects the direct operational performance of the corporate-owned store portfolio, including food and beverage sales. This figure is a key indicator of the company's direct exposure to retail-level consumer demand and operational costs.
